Package com.vaadin.spring.boot.internal
Class VaadinServletConfiguration
java.lang.Object
com.vaadin.spring.boot.internal.VaadinServletConfiguration
- All Implemented Interfaces:
org.springframework.beans.factory.InitializingBean
@Configuration
@EnableConfigurationProperties(VaadinServletConfigurationProperties.class)
public class VaadinServletConfiguration
extends Object
implements org.springframework.beans.factory.InitializingBean
Spring configuration that sets up a
SpringVaadinServlet. If you want to
customize the servlet, extend it and make it available as a Spring bean.
By default, unless a custom mapping of the Vaadin servlet is performed using
the URL mapping configuration property
VaadinServletConfigurationProperties.getUrlMapping(), the Vaadin
servlet is mapped to a hidden path not to block requests destined to
DispatcherServlet. ServletForwardingController is then mapped
so that requests to all SpringUI paths are forwarded to the servlet
for the generation of a bootstrap page, which internally uses the Vaadin
servlet path for all other communication.
This approach currently relies on a hack that modifies request servlet path
and path info on the fly as those produced by
ServletForwardingController are not what VaadinServlet
expects. See SpringVaadinServlet for more information on this.
